Family Literacy Day, January 27th - WIN PRIZES!

Take a Learning Journey....ABC Life Literacy Canada, the Warner County Literacy Program and the Raymond Public LIbrary invite all Canadians to take a learning journey for FAmily LIteracy Day 2012.

How can YOU get involved????

1. Pick up a Journey to Learning Passport from the Raymond Public Library.
2. Complete and check off at least 5 activities on your passport in the weeks leading up to January 27th.
3. Register your passport at http://www.familyliteracy/ Day.ca for a chance to WIN one of three national prize packages.
4. Return your completed passport to the Raymond Public Library for a chance to WIN our local family prize.

Family Literacy Day Colouring Contest
You can pick up applications for the second annual Family Literacy Day Colouring Contest at the Raymond Public Library. Have your child colour the picture and answer the questionson the application, then mail it to the address on the form and you will have a chance to WIN a prize package.

We Remember Them

Tuesday, November 9, 2010 at 2:00
Recently a local couple visited many of the Canadian War memorial sites in France. This videoconference will be a slide show presentation with commentary about their trip and experiences. This talk will give an overview of the memorials and some insights into organizing a similar journey.
